Many static findings are Markdown fences or inline app identifiers and were marked false positive for Ruby-style backtick execution. The actual infsh examples are confirmed medium-risk external commands because they authenticate, publish, delete, message, follow, or retrieve data through a connected X account. A high-confidence semantic finding remains for social engagement automation that could support spam or platform manipulation without guardrails.
These are real local capabilities that may be expected for this skill, so they require review but are not counted as confirmed malicious behavior.
